What is our Lifelong Job Guidance Program?
Simple, it is our endless support for the rest of your TEFL career when it comes to finding teaching
positions worldwide. Through our job guidance program, you will receive coaching every step of the way
in securing teaching positions worldwide as well as direct employment contacts for what ever country
you decide to venture into. Our extensive EFL school network, international academic prestige, and
countless professional resources will be laid down at your complete disposal.
The following are the components of our job Guidance program:
Country specific information
We have packets of information on virtually every major teaching destination in the world. These packets
include: schools in the area, contacts of past graduates working there, living conditions, average wages,
and the general teaching environment. This information is readily available to every TEFL trainee from the
start of the course.
CV preparation
We help write, review, and redraft your CV/resume during the third week of the course. This also includes
assistance with cover letters.
Mock interviews
During the last week of the course we conduct individual mock interviews with all trainees to simulate what
it might be like on your first interview. These interviews take about 15 minutes and cover questions
related with grammar and teaching methodology.
Letters of recommendation and post course support
This includes writing letters of recommendation, speaking to other course directors over the phone, as
well as post-course follow ups to see how you are doing.
All these resources are available for you for the rest of your TEFL career for as many times as you
need it! The only condition is that you are not fired from your previous teaching position due to poor
performance or unprofessional conduct.
